**Facilities Ticket — Night Shift**

Site: Dovelance Annex, Lab 3B (shared with the Merrow team). Their fume cupboard alarm has been tripping after midnight; ours is fine. Please check the shared ventilation panel on your round and reset if needed. The lab door locks automatically after 22:00, so you'll need the shared-access pass to get in. Current code follows:

turnstile pass: bdg-TXR-4

Handover from Dessa to Orin re: Lanternshop catalog cache invalidation. Purge events are signed and verified at the edge worker; unsigned purges are dropped and logged. Key risk: the legacy bulk-invalidate endpoint still bypasses signature checks. Audit scope and the token rotation schedule are documented on the internal page linked below.

runbook for badug-kadup: https://confluence.zemvarlabs.internal/projects/browse/display/projects/bd1b

TURN-208: Gatevale turnstile counters at the Merrow Field pilot double-count when a rotation reverses mid-cycle. Attendance totals drift roughly 2% high per event. The debounce window fix is implemented, reviewed by Ilsa, and soak-tested across two simulated match days without drift. Ready for your cut; the candidate build is identified below.

trace token, tagag-tafog: htk6_5ed18c